Monday to Thursday - 3:30pm to 1am, rotating weekends
At Hood Container Corporation, we’re searching for a 2 nd Shift converting supervisor at our Covington, KY plant. This position will be scheduled to support corrugated converting operation to include flexos, diecutters, and folder gluers. This role is responsible for managing plant employees to meet manufacturing and production schedules, providing overall direction to production floor employees, including production, scheduling, performance management, training and other related areas, striving to improve overall operational efficiencies during the designated shift. This role is responsible for coordinating production operations and maintaining effective quality procedures and safety regulations for the facility.
How You Will Contribute
- Develops short and long-term courses of action that support the organization's overall vision and mission; balances business, technical, and operational issues when determining a strategy; identifies problems with current strategies and suggests ways to resolve them
- Manage the day-to-day operations of the shift with constant emphasis on safety, quality, waste, delivery and cost
- Motivate employees to keep operations running smoothly and safely.
- Maintain agility, flexibility, and a willingness to modify one’s approach to achieve desired results; responds quickly to changing demands, processes, and updated information
- Support continuous improvement initiatives and enforce control procedures, recommending improvements to the Plant Manager, as appropriate
- Plan, assign and direct work for all hourly production employees; appraise performance and provide feedback as needed; assist in resolving complaints; hold employees accountable as needed; communicate issues and results on a daily basis
- Required: High School diploma or G.E.D. with equivalent experience
- Three (3) or more years in a leadership role within the manufacturing industry
- Experience in the corrugated industry preferred
- Must be able to work high temperature & humidity conditions while wearing proper PPE including, but not limited to, hearing protection, steel toe shoes and safety glasses
- Ability to work in a fast-paced and dynamic environment
- Must be willing to work shift (3:30pm - 1am)
